Abstract

In this paper, a technique has been proposed for detecting edge in medical images throughput from computed tomography and magnetic resonance imaging devices. The proposed technique is Gabor wavelet transform along with two clustering methods i. e. Fuzzy c-means with k-means which is used to adorn the edge information while suppressing noise.
